Andriod开发测试用例
Andriod版手机通测试用例
修订历史记录
| 日期 | 版本 | 说明 | 作者 | 
|  |  | Beta版 |  | 
|  |  |  |  | 
|  |  |  |  | 
|  |  |  |  | 
|  |  |  |  | 
| 用例编号 | 测试功能 | 验收标准 | 重要级别 | 测试输入 | 预期结果 | 
| 性能测试 | |||||
| 1.          | 客户端通信基类模块 | 对应发送服务器能接收的命令,并返回结束,提供给UI层操作 | 用户名:60487 密码:123456 | 待机一天,再次可以使用 | |
| 2.          | 客户数据库操作模块 | 实现选择出发地或目的地,并生成把回相应的查询条件 |  | 用户名:60487 密码:123456 | 待机一天,再次可以使用 | 
| 3.          | 出发地目地地公用模块 | 实现选择出发地或目的地,并生成把回相应的查询条件 |  | 出发地:沈阳 目的地:北京 | 正确显示填写的出发地和目的地 | 
| 4.          | 程序菜单 | 显示出程序所有的功能列表 |  | 用户名:60487 密码:123456 | 每次登录保证登录功能齐全 | 
| 5.          | 程序启动显示进度 | 程序启动时显示程序当前的操作 |  | 用户名: 密码: | 出现进度光环 | 
| 6.          | 启动程序同步服务器时间 |  |  | 用户名: 密码: | 待机一天,再次可以使用 | 
| 7.          | 显示查询信息模块 | 实现查询,显示数据控制在一行控件中,并提供翻页功能,些模块涉及的代码比较多 |  | 车源条件、货源条件、综合条件 | 显示每个查询的输入条件的输出结果 | 
| 8.          | 保持网络连接 | 网络错误后,程序自动连接并可以操作服务器命令 |  | 用户名: 密码: | 待机一天,再次可以使用 | 
| 9.          | 用户其它端程序退出程序 (踢人功能) | 数据库状态更改后,程序自动退出 |  | Web 端用户名: 密码: | 使用同一号一端登录 ;另一端强制下线 | 
| 10.      | 登陆功能模块 | 实现登陆功能,第一次登陆自动绑定用户的设备ID,保存登录信息功能,自动登陆功能,登录验证功能 |  | 用户名: 密码: |  | 
| 11.      | 车源添加 | 用户输入的正确验证,正确发布车源信息 |  | 必填条件/ | 成功添加  | 
| 12.      | 货源添加 | 用户输入的正确验证,正确发布货源信 |  | 必填条件 | 成功添加 | 
| 13.      | 用户信息管理模块-查询 | 实现查询条件设置 |  | 查询必填条件 | 显示条件相符 | 
| 14.      | 用户信息管理模块-查询结果 | 设置好查询条件后返回相就的查询内容 |  | 查询必填条件 | 显示条件相符,可以显示结果 | 
| 15.      | 用户信息管理模块-删除所发布信息 | 对该用户所发布的信息删除 |  |  | 删除信息 | 
| 16.      | 系统设置 | 程序自动登陆后,在设置里面取消 |  |  |  | 
| 17.      | 退出 | 正确退出程序 |  |  | 成功退出 | 
| 18.      | 成功退出,待机后使用 | 待机一段时间后,可以成功操作系统功能。 |  |  | 可以退出后使用 | 
| 19.      | 车源查询-车源查询条件模块 | 控制查询条件,控制条件选择如:时间段、目的地、出发地、长宽高,等一些条件 |  | 必填条件 | 可以产生相应结果 | 
| 20.      | 货源查询-货源查询条件模块 | 控制查询条件,控制条件选择如:时间段、目的地、出发地、长宽高,等一些条件 |  | 必填条件 | 可以产生相应结果 | 
| 21.      | 货源查询-车源详细显示模块 | 实现车源详细内容的显示,含有开关控制 |  | 必填条件 | 可以产生相应结果 | 
| 22.      | 综合查询-综合查询页模块 | 控制查询条件,控制条件选择如:时间段、目的地、出发地、长宽高,等一些条件、车源货源全部 |  | 必填条件 | 可以产生相应结果 | 
| 23.      | 个人信息管理-个人信息的修改 | 能够正确修改个人信息 |  | 必填条件 | 有提示,修改成功 | 
| 24.      | 个人信息管理-密码修改 | 能够正确修改个人密码 |  | 必填条件 | 有提示,修改成功 | 
| 25.      | 帮助和关于 | 能够正常显示帮助文档和关于信息 |  |  | 显示 无错别字 | 
| 26.      | 新版本检查与更新功能 | 当有新版本发布时能够在程序的启动过程中检测到并升级 |  |  | 可以升级 | 
| 一致性测试 | |||||
| 27.      | 提示的合适是否一致 |  |  |  |  | 
| 28.      | 菜单的合适是否一致 |  |  |  |  | 
| 29.      | 帮助的格式是否一致 |  |  |  |  | 
| 30.      | 提示、菜单、帮助中的术语是否一致 |  |  |  |  | 
| 31.      | 各个控件之间的对齐方式是否一致 |  |  |  |  | 
| 32.      | 输入界面和输出界面在外观、布局、交互方式上是否一致 |  |  |  |  | 
| 33.      | 功能类似的相关界面是否在外观、布局、交互方式上是否一致(比如商品代码检索和商品名称检索) |  |  |  |  | 
| 34.      | 连续多个界面情况是否存在?界面的外观、操作方式是否一致 |  |  |  |  | 
| 信息反馈测试 | |||||
| 35.      | 是否接受客户的正确输入并做提示 |  |  |  |  | 
| 36.      | 是否拒绝客户的错误输入并做提示 |  |  |  |  | 
| 37.      | 提示用语是否按警告级别和完成程度进行分级 |  |  |  |  | 
| 38.      | 提示所用的图标或图形是否具有代表性和警示性 |  |  |  |  | 
| 39.      | 系统在界面(菜单、工具条)上是否提供突显功能(如鼠标移动到控件时图标变大或颜色变化) |  |  |  |  | 
| 40.      | 系统是否在用户完成操作时给出操作成功的提示 |  |  |  |  | 
| 界面简洁性测试 | |||||
| 41.      | 前景与背景色是否反差过大 |  |  |  |  | 
| 42.      | 字体大小是否与界面成比例 |  |  |  |  | 
| 43.      |  |  |  |  |  | 
| 44.      |  |  |  |  |  | 
| 45.      |  |  |  |  |  | 
| 46.      |  |  |  |  |  | 
| 47.      |  |  |  |  |  |